Choosing the Right Luggage

Choosing the right luggage is the first step in packing for Miraj Green Makkah. Opt for a suitcase that is lightweight, durable, and easy to carry. If you are traveling by air, a medium-sized suitcase combined with a backpack is ideal. A backpack can hold daily essentials like water, prayer mats, and snacks while you are outside. Rolling clothes instead of folding can save space and prevent wrinkles, which is especially useful for maintaining your modest attire.

Clothing Essentials

When packing for Miraj Green Makkah, clothing is the most critical factor. Makkah has a hot climate, so lightweight and breathable clothing is necessary. Men should pack simple, loose-fitting clothes like cotton shirts, pants, and Ihram garments for Umrah. Women should bring modest clothing, including abayas and scarves. Make sure your clothing is easy to wash and quick-drying, as this can be very helpful during long stays.

Layering is also important. Even though Makkah is generally hot, air-conditioned spaces at Miraj Green Makkah can be chilly. Bringing a light sweater or shawl can provide comfort indoors without overheating outdoors. Avoid heavy jackets or thick clothes that take up unnecessary space.

Footwear for Comfort and Safety

Packing the right footwear is vital for a stay at Miraj Green Makkah. Comfortable shoes are a must because you will walk a lot during your visit to Masjid al-Haram and surrounding areas. Sneakers or walking shoes with good support are highly recommended. For women, simple sandals that are easy to slip on and off are practical for prayer times. Avoid packing high heels or shoes that can cause blisters, as they can make long walks difficult.

Toiletries and Personal Care

While Miraj Green Makkah provides basic toiletries, it is best to carry your personal items for convenience. Pack travel-sized shampoo, conditioner, soap, toothpaste, and a toothbrush. Include personal hygiene items like wet wipes, hand sanitizer, and tissues. If you use skincare products, make sure they are suitable for hot climates to prevent discomfort.

For men, a small grooming kit including a razor and comb is useful, while women may want to bring minimal makeup and hair accessories. Remember, packing light with multipurpose toiletries can save space in your luggage.

Health and Safety Essentials

Health and safety should never be overlooked when packing for Miraj Green Makkah. Carry a basic first-aid kit with items like band-aids, pain relievers, antiseptic wipes, and any prescription medications. Include sunscreen and lip balm to protect yourself from the sun. A reusable water bottle is essential to stay hydrated during long walks and prayer times.

It’s also wise to have masks, hand sanitizer, and personal hygiene items ready, as Makkah can be crowded. Travel insurance documents and a small copy of your passport can be stored in your backpack for emergencies.

Electronics and Connectivity

In today’s digital age, electronics are important for a comfortable stay at Miraj Green Makkah. Bring a smartphone, charger, and power bank to keep your devices charged throughout the day. A universal travel adapter may also be necessary if your devices use different plug types.

Some travelers prefer carrying a small camera to capture memories, but remember to respect privacy and religious norms. Noise-canceling headphones can also be useful if you want some quiet time in your hotel room. Avoid overpacking electronic devices; choose only what you will use frequently.

Travel Documents and Money

Proper documentation is crucial for a smooth stay at Miraj Green Makkah. Carry your passport, visa, flight tickets, hotel booking confirmation, and any travel insurance documents. Keep both physical and digital copies of all documents in separate locations to avoid misplacement.

Regarding money, bring a combination of cash and cards. While Makkah has ATMs and card facilities, having small denominations of local currency can be convenient for tips and small purchases. A money belt or secure pouch can help protect your valuables while exploring the city.

Packing for Spiritual Needs

A trip to Miraj Green Makkah is not just about sightseeing—it’s a spiritual journey. Packing items that support your religious practices is essential. Include prayer mats, pocket Qurans, prayer beads, and comfortable clothing suitable for prayer. Women may need extra scarves for prayer, while men might want a small bag to carry prayer essentials while outside.

Consider packing a small notebook or journal for reflections. This can be useful for recording your spiritual experiences and thoughts during your stay.

Snacks and Food Items

While Miraj Green Makkah provides meals, carrying light snacks can be helpful during long outings. Dry fruits, nuts, energy bars, and bottled water are practical for staying energized. These items are easy to carry in your backpack and can be consumed without preparation. Avoid packing perishable food items that may spoil in the hot climate of Makkah.

Packing for Different Durations of Stay

The duration of your stay at Miraj Green Makkah affects what and how much you pack. For a short stay, a carry-on bag with essential items is sufficient. For a longer stay, consider packing more clothing, toiletries, and extra prayer items. If your stay exceeds a week, laundry services at Miraj Green Makkah can help reduce the need for excessive clothing.

Seasonal Considerations

Makkah experiences high temperatures most of the year, but the season can still impact your packing. During summer, lightweight and breathable fabrics are crucial. During winter months, temperatures can be cooler in the evenings, so a light sweater or shawl is recommended. Staying aware of seasonal weather ensures you are comfortable both at Miraj Green Makkah and during outdoor activities.

Cultural Sensitivity in Packing

Makkah is a city with strong religious and cultural norms. When packing for Miraj Green Makkah, it is important to respect these norms. Women should avoid tight or revealing clothing, and men should dress modestly. Avoid flashy or inappropriate accessories. This ensures you feel comfortable and respectful during your visit.
